Yeah, I am Hungarian but I also manage to understand a few words in English. However in my country, if a program is not translated, most likely it will not be used by 95% of the people. And from my experiences, I know that this is nearly the same in other countries too. I have worked a lot in multinational environment so I know this is similar in other countries too. There are many countries where people are simply refusing to learn other languages because of their pride and other things (stupidity for example). This doesn't mean they are not potential users. Most company's first priority is to offer their services on at least 5-6 major languages. And other companies have these choices:
1. Adapting to the trends and translate whatever crap they are selling.
2. Vanishing in a dark pit and let other, more flexible companies take their place.
I for one don't care about the translation but I think it would substantially raise the number of CE users. And this is just an opinion based on my experiences, not a request for multi-language support or any attempt to open a debate about it.
As for "You" with capital "Y", I am just used to it from official mailing regarding my work. It is still used in many countries (even if it is not used by English people) and it is a sign of respect which is often appreciated by the addressed person.
As for "Also(2)", I was thinking the same but who am I to criticize so I kept my opinion for myself.
Basic CE options are not so complicated and they can be used without any extra knowledge. More advanced options would require some ASM knowledge anyway and to learn ASM, the best sources are in English so no choice. Anyone who is serious about "hacking" will have to learn English too. So translations would probably increase the number of "noob" users only, but who knows. I have seen many people who didn't speak English at all, but they were still considered to be successful.
